Synopsis

Until very recently, the path to success within the music industry was much clearer. The successful combination of song, producer, talent and potential would capture the attention of a record label ... and their machinery, belief and investment would launch the artist into the realms of radio and touring.

Now, various and often conflicting opportunities float in what have become cloudy waters. Successful YouTubers get record deals. Unsigned high school students produce songs in their bedrooms and hit the iTunes charts. Reality stars with large followings and no musical talent sell out arenas, and established successful musicians now compete for space on Snapchat with popular “tweens” that already have product endorsements.

Times have changed, and today’s artists have multiple paths toward building and sustaining a career. Hacking Music explores these alternative routes and provides a road map, compass, and tools with which they can map out their own careers and better understand the moving parts that make up the current music marketplace.

Hacking Music has one singular mission - empower the artist to make his or her own career by providing examples, insights and exercises within these vital areas:

Strategic Planning and Execution
Developing “Supersongs”
Team Building
Platform and Content Development
Lean Music Methodology
Industry and Publishing Business Models

Hacking Music is a book that you do, not just to get you to a record deal, but to get you through a record deal. Hacking Music takes the artist “behind the curtain” and shares the concepts and systems used daily by industry professionals and authors John Pisciotta of Jetpack Artist Ventures and Wade Sutton of Rocket to the Stars Artist Services that will bring you back to this book again and again as you build your career.

About the Author

WADE SUTTON
Rocket to the Stars Artist Services

With clients in major cities like Nashville, New York, London, and Toronto, Rocket to the Stars' Wade Sutton utilizes more than twenty years of professional radio, journalism, and music industry experience to help artists in all aspects of their careers. His strategies have been featured on top websites for independent musicians such as CD Baby and Disc Makers. Wade's previous book, The $150,000 Music Degree, was co-authored with former Taylor Swift manager Rick Barker and Wade was a featured speaker at the 2018 Music Entrepreneur Conference at Harvard University. He is also the host of The Six Minute Music Business Podcast which can be heard on iTunes, Google Play, TuneIn and Stitcher.

JOHN PISCIOTTA
Executive Producer - Jetpack Artist Ventures

John Pisciotta is the managing director of Jetpack Artist Ventures, a Nashville-based venture studio accelerating high-potential media properties, both iconic and developing, across the divisions of recording, music publishing, artist services, and artist management. In addition to raising substantial capital for artists, Pisciotta's work with Jetpack has helped client-artists receive an ACM nomination for "Musician of the Year" and American Music Award "Song of the Year" and "Video of the Year" nominations. Pisciotta has also created and taught courses at Nashville's Belmont University.
